The margin of error is a critical statistical measure that quantifies the uncertainty in survey results or polling data. This guide explains how to calculate and interpret margin of error for your research.
Margin of error represents the range within which the true population value is likely to fall. It's expressed as a plus-or-minus percentage that indicates the precision of your sample estimate. A smaller margin of error means more confidence in your results.

For most general-purpose surveys, a sample size of 1,000 with a 95% confidence level provides a margin of error of about ±3%. This is considered the industry standard for national polling.
